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ions
Android versions Android-8.1 through Android-10
Description
The issue is related to a permissions bypass in the
setNiNotification function of GpsNetInitiatedHandler.java, caused by an empty mutable PendingIntent. This could lead to local escalation of privilege, requiring User execution privileges. No user interaction is needed for exploitation.Recommendations
For Android versions Android-8.1 through Android-10, at the moment, there is no information about a newer version that contains a fix for this issue.
